Default Sway bars

Which ones are better?

Hotchkis or the Mopar sway bars?

Hotchkis has bigger fronts than Mopar.

Mopar has bigger rears that Hotckis.

I would think the fronts make the most difference?

Banana,
Be careful on this one... too big, too small, or not correct balancefor the car will make it unstable on hard cornering -- just what you didn't want. Understeer, oversteer, and a host of problems by messing with what is already pretty good will break the tires loose quicker, plow ahead further, or who knows what may happen... I have no idea who to check with this one... maybe someone is running hot laps with a Charger at a SCCA rally course, ask the guys at your manufacturer to talk large cars, or just ask a trooper to see if they like their set up during a pursuit...
